San Diego Native Embarks on Trucking Adventure with Her Beloved Cat

Meet Heather Krebs: The Unconventional Truck Driver

Purple-haired truck driver Heather Krebs, who travels with her hairless Sphynx cat named Pebbles (affectionately called “Squish”), doesn’t conform to the stereotype of a typical trucker. For Krebs, having her feline companion on board was non-negotiable when considering a career in trucking. “If I couldn’t bring her, I wouldn’t have done it,” Krebs remarked, emphasizing her deep bond with Pebbles.

A Lifelong Animal Lover

Krebs has always had a passion for animals, confirmed by her 16 years of experience as a veterinary medicine technician, during which she adopted five cats, including Pebbles. “It’s not unheard of in the veterinary field,” she explained. While owning five Sphynx cats may seem unusual, Krebs feels it perfectly aligns with her personality.

Finding Her Feline Connection

Though Krebs identifies more as a dog person, she is particularly fond of Sphynx cats for their friendly demeanor and sociable nature. Her affection for the breed began when she first saw one on television as a child, and she vowed that if she ever had a cat, it would be a Sphynx. The companionship of these cats has helped her through personal struggles, including depression and divorce.

Transitioning Careers

Despite enjoying her time as a vet tech, Krebs faced physical challenges that led to surgeries on her hands. After one particular surgery, she joined her truck-driving boyfriend, Kelly Jones, on a three-week trip and quickly fell in love with the lifestyle. This experience sparked her interest in pursuing a career in trucking, especially as her children were now grown and graduated from college.

Embracing Change

Krebs is eager to see parts of the country she’s never explored, especially as a lifelong Californian who has lived in San Diego. “I haven’t seen many other places,” she said, expressing her enthusiasm for the adventure that lies ahead. When Jones suggested the idea of relocating, Krebs was open to it, considering the opportunities that living elsewhere could provide.

A Unique Road Companion

As Krebs wraps up her CDL training with Knight Transportation, she made sure to clarify that she could bring a cat along for the journey. She faced the tough decision of choosing which of her five cats to accompany her; Pebbles emerged as the best choice due to her temperament. Though the other cats will be cared for by friends during her travels, Krebs treasures the moments spent with Pebbles as her co-pilot.

A Symbol of Resilience

In addition to her love for cats, Krebs expresses her individuality through her vibrant purple hair, a tribute to her survival journey after overcoming breast cancer. She embraces her freedom and the exciting life changes ahead. With Pebbles by her side, Krebs feels she has found the life she was always meant to lead, embodying resilience and adventure on the open road.
